How the treatment works
This facial layers targeted hydration, gentle exfoliation and barrier-supporting serums to soften surface texture and improve the way skin reflects light. Each step is intended to smooth microscopic unevenness and boost temporary luminosity, producing the “glass-skin” look without pursuing aggressive clinical resurfacing or deeper corrective procedures.
Because the method focuses on surface polish and moisture, estheticians select techniques that preserve the skin barrier while enhancing surface clarity. The approach is designed to create an immediately brighter appearance, not to replace medical treatments for scarring, deep lines, or significant pigmentary concerns.
Who this facial suits
Clients with dull or dehydrated skin typically see the most benefit from this service. Preparing and scheduling
Plan to arrive with minimal makeup so your esthetician can assess skin and tailor product layering. A brief professional consultation begins every session to identify sensitivities or recent procedures; if you have active skin issues, disclose them in advance so we can determine suitability.
